Chuyên viên DevOp nghiên cứu về Trí tuệ nhân tạo

Các công cụ AI dành cho DevOps: Những lựa chọn tốt nhất

Bằng cách tận dụng học máy và tự động hóa, các công cụ AI dành cho DevOps giúp nâng cao hiệu quả, khả năng mở rộng và độ tin cậy trong phát triển và vận hành phần mềm.

Trong bài viết này, chúng ta sẽ cùng tìm hiểu:
🔹 Vai trò của AI trong DevOps
🔹 Các công cụ AI tốt nhất cho DevOps
🔹 Những lợi ích và trường hợp sử dụng chính
🔹 Cách chọn công cụ AI phù hợp với nhu cầu của bạn

Những bài viết bạn có thể muốn đọc sau bài này:

🔗 Trí tuệ nhân tạo nào tốt nhất cho việc lập trình? – Các trợ lý lập trình AI hàng đầu – Khám phá các công cụ lập trình AI hàng đầu với tính năng tự động hoàn thành, phát hiện lỗi và đề xuất theo thời gian thực để tăng tốc quá trình phát triển.

🔗 Các công cụ đánh giá mã AI tốt nhất – Nâng cao chất lượng và hiệu quả mã – Khám phá các công cụ AI mạnh mẽ giúp phân tích, đánh giá và tối ưu hóa mã của bạn để đảm bảo tiêu chuẩn cao và giảm lỗi.

🔗 Các công cụ AI tốt nhất dành cho nhà phát triển phần mềm – Trợ lý lập trình hàng đầu được hỗ trợ bởi AI – Hướng dẫn toàn diện về các trợ lý phát triển AI giúp tối ưu hóa quá trình lập trình, gỡ lỗi và triển khai.

🔗 Các công cụ AI không cần lập trình tốt nhất – Khai thác sức mạnh AI mà không cần viết một dòng mã nào – Xây dựng và triển khai các mô hình AI bằng các nền tảng trực quan không yêu cầu kỹ năng lập trình — hoàn hảo cho người không phải lập trình viên.

Cùng khám phá nào! 🌊


🧠 Vai trò của AI trong DevOps

Trí tuệ nhân tạo (AI) đang cách mạng hóa DevOps bằng cách tự động hóa các tác vụ phức tạp, cải thiện độ tin cậy của hệ thống và nâng cao quy trình ra quyết định. Dưới đây là cách AI đang chuyển đổi DevOps:

Kiểm tra và rà soát mã tự động

Các công cụ dựa trên trí tuệ nhân tạo có thể phân tích chất lượng mã, phát hiện lỗ hổng và đề xuất các cải tiến trước khi triển khai.

Các quy trình CI/CD thông minh

Máy học tối ưu hóa quy trình Tích hợp liên tục/Triển khai liên tục (CI/CD) bằng cách dự đoán lỗi, đơn giản hóa quá trình xây dựng và tự động hóa việc hoàn tác .

Cơ sở hạ tầng tự phục hồi

Các công cụ giám sát dựa trên trí tuệ nhân tạo dự đoánngăn ngừa sự cố hệ thống bằng cách phát hiện các bất thường và áp dụng các biện pháp khắc phục tự động.

Tăng cường bảo mật và tuân thủ

Các công cụ bảo mật dựa trên trí tuệ nhân tạo phân tích hành vi mạng, phát hiện các mối đe dọa và tự động kiểm tra tuân thủ để giảm thiểu rủi ro bảo mật.


🔥 Các công cụ AI hàng đầu dành cho DevOps

những công cụ AI mạnh mẽ nhất có thể thay đổi quy trình làm việc của bạn:

🛠 1. Dynatrace – Khả năng quan sát được hỗ trợ bởi AI

Các tính năng chính:
🔹 Phát hiện bất thường tự động
🔹 Phân tích nguyên nhân gốc rễ dựa trên AI
🔹 Giám sát đám mây và thông tin chi tiết theo thời gian thực

🔗 Trang web chính thức của Dynatrace

🤖 2. GitHub Copilot – Trợ lý lập trình AI

Các tính năng chính:
🔹 Gợi ý mã lệnh dựa trên trí tuệ nhân tạo
🔹 Gỡ lỗi tự động
🔹 Hỗ trợ nhiều ngôn ngữ lập trình

🔗 GitHub Copilot

🔍 3. New Relic – Giám sát được hỗ trợ bởi AI

Các tính năng chính:
🔹 Phân tích dự đoán hiệu suất hệ thống
🔹 Cảnh báo dựa trên AI để giải quyết sự cố
🔹 Khả năng quan sát toàn diện

🔗 Di vật mới

🚀 4. Harness – Trí tuệ nhân tạo cho các quy trình CI/CD

Các tính năng chính:
🔹 Xác minh triển khai tự động
🔹 Khôi phục và dự đoán lỗi dựa trên AI
🔹 Tối ưu hóa chi phí cho môi trường đám mây

🔗 Harness.io

🔑 5. AIOps của Splunk – Quản lý sự cố thông minh

Các tính năng chính:
Phân tích và đối chiếu nhật ký
dựa trên AI 🔹 Giải quyết sự cố dự đoán
🔹 Tự động hóa các phản hồi bảo mật

🔗 Splunk AIOps


📌 Những lợi ích chính của công cụ AI đối với DevOps

Ứng dụng AI trong DevOps mang lại hiệu quả và độ tin cậy vượt trội. Dưới đây là lý do tại sao các tổ chức hàng đầu đang áp dụng nó:

🚀 1. Triển khai nhanh hơn

Trí tuệ nhân tạo (AI) tự động hóa các quy trình xây dựng, kiểm thử và triển khai, giảm thiểu lỗi và công sức thủ công.

2. Giải quyết vấn đề một cách chủ động

Các mô hình học máy phát hiện các bất thường và vấn đề về hiệu năng trước khi chúng ảnh hưởng đến người dùng.

🔒 3. Tăng cường bảo mật

nhân tạo (AI) liên tục giám sát lưu lượng mạng, các lỗ hổng mã nguồn và phát hiện mối đe dọa để nâng cao an ninh mạng.

🏆 4. Tối ưu hóa chi phí

Bằng cách dự đoán mức sử dụng tài nguyên và tối ưu hóa quy trình làm việc , các công cụ AI giúp giảm chi phí điện toán đám mây và chi phí vận hành.

🔄 5. Học hỏi và cải tiến liên tục

Các mô hình AI thích nghi theo thời gian, học hỏi từ các lần triển khai trước đó để nâng cao độ chính xác và hiệu quả.


🧐 Làm thế nào để chọn công cụ AI phù hợp cho DevOps?

Khi lựa chọn công cụ AI cho DevOps , hãy cân nhắc các yếu tố sau:

🔹 Trường hợp sử dụng: Công cụ này chuyên về giám sát, bảo mật, CI/CD hay tự động hóa ?
🔹 Tích hợp: Nó có hoạt động liền mạch với hệ thống DevOps (Jenkins, Kubernetes, AWS, v.v.) không?
🔹 Khả năng mở rộng: Công cụ này có thể xử lý khối lượng công việc và môi trường đám mây không?
🔹 Chi phí so với ROI: Nó có mang lại giá trị về hiệu quả, bảo mật và tiết kiệm dài hạn ?
🔹 Hỗ trợ & Cộng đồng:hỗ trợ và tài liệu tích cực nào không?

Tìm kiếm những công nghệ AI mới nhất tại AI Assistant Store

Quay lại blog